> If you know that you are going to change the card download the driver
> software before you make the change. After the hardware change boot to
> runlevel 3, install the drivers, and run "system-config-display
> --reconfig".
>
You might want to hold off upgrading to F7 if your using a X1300, as the
open source driver doesn't support it and ATI's drivers don't yet
support F7.
